Penn Highlands Jefferson Manor, located in Brookville, Pennsylvania, is a senior care facility that offers both nursing home and assisted living services. As part of the Penn Highlands Healthcare network, Jefferson Manor provides skilled nursing care as well as support for residents who require assistance with daily activities. The facility currently houses 124 occupants and is certified by both Medicare and Medicaid, participating in the Medicare program since January 1, 1984. The campus supports a variety of care needs, including short-term rehabilitation, long-term care, and continuing care, in addition to offering respite care services for temporary stays. The environment is designed to support residents who require some physical assistance with activities such as bathing, dressing, eating, and toileting.
Residents at Penn Highlands Jefferson Manor have access to a range of healthcare and therapy services. The facility offers 24-hour nursing support, with licensed nurses available to monitor health needs and provide medical care. Physical therapy, occupational therapy, and speech therapy programs are available onsite, helping residents recover from illness, injury, or surgery and maintain or improve their functional abilities. The staff includes professionals dedicated to each type of rehabilitation, working with residents to meet individualized care plans. Additionally, the facility provides resident and family counseling services to assist with emotional and social needs, and a resident/family council fosters communication and involvement in the care environment.
